No direct experience with Araucaria araucana but a lot of observations of other local Araucaria spp. eg Hoop Pines and Bunya Pines - similar growth habit and form to Monkey Puzzels.
Good luck - there is not much you can do that won't make it look as though it has been lopped (topped) unless it has the sometimes typical co-dominant leaders.
Observation: After a few years - in fact quite a few, after the laterals have become "clumped" below the cut, one or two laterals may become dominant but it will be an odd shape. This doesn't always appear to happen though.

I would be interested if anyone has had more positive success than this.
